2014-04-18 48 views
0

我想爲我正在使用的microSD卡創建四個分區表,但我遇到了一些困難。我可以使用在線提供的無數教程創建四個分區。例如,我做sudo fdisk /dev/sdc訪問該卡。我使用n創建四個分區並分配它們的大小和類型。最後,我輸入w保存並退出。創建,格式化和掛載分區表

當我通過執行sudo fdisk -l來檢查是否創建了分區時,我能夠看到四個分區。

然而,當我嘗試格式化我已經做/sbin/mkfs -t ext3 /dev/sdc1創建的分區(第一個分區),我不能因爲sdc1不存在,它只是給了我scd作爲一個選項。

因此,我無法裝入分區,因爲我無法格式化它們。

任何人都可以請幫我解決這個問題嗎?

編輯

當我嘗試保存分區表與w的問題在於,它給了我一個錯誤說:

警告:重讀分區表錯誤22失敗: 無效的論點。內核仍然使用舊錶。舊錶格將在下次重新啓動時或在運行partprobe(8)或kpartx(8)後使用。

這是什麼意思,我該如何解決?

此外,當我使用v驗證表,我得到(每個分區):

分區1:前次部門64547個不服,總64603

爲什麼會這樣呢?

回答

1

您可以使用以下任一格式化

mke4fs -t EXT3的/ dev/SDC1

mkfs.ext3的/ dev/SDC1

+0

請檢查編輯。 – Adam

+0

只是重新啓動系統或使用partx命令http://www.tutorialspoint.com/unix_commands/partx.htm – AVM

+0

我已經這樣做,但它沒有改變任何東西。 – Adam